You've probably never seen this. It's the original 60 second version of "How many Licks does it take to get to the tootsie Roll center of a Tootsie Pop". This commercial aired in 1969 and may be the longest running TV commercial in history.

The cow (bull?) is Frank Nelson, whose trademark phrase was "Eh-yesssss?" in various sitcoms, and radio shows, usually as a smart-alecky clerk. The fox is voice legend Paul Frees (Boris Badinov and many others), I don't know the turtle's voice and the owl is Paul Winchell (Does Dick Dastardly or Tigger ring a bell?).
